PHOTOS: Scenes from ‘Iron Man 3’ Downey Jr. reprises his role as the genius billionaire whose metal suit allows him to fly and fight uber-powerful bad guys. Directed by Shane Black (“Kiss Kiss Bang Bang”), “Iron Man 3” is the first Marvel movie to hit theaters since Iron Man teamed up with Captain America, Thor, the Hulk, Black Widow and Hawkeye for “The Avengers,” which broke box office records last summer. In “Iron Man 3,” Tony Stark faces off against the Mandarin, an arch-nemesis whose ring-garbed fingers are a familiar sight to comic book fans. In the comics, the Mandarin was an exiled orphan who discovered a crashed spaceship, mastered the alien science he found there and kept 10 powerful rings used to drive the ship. He used the rings’ power in his schemes for world domination. Ben Kingsley plays the Mandarin in the film, and other cast members include Gwyneth Paltrow as Pepper Potts, Don Cheadle as James Rhodes, “Iron Man” and “Iron Man 2” director Jon Favreau as Happy Hogan, and Guy Pearce as Aldrich Killian, a scientist who in the comics sells a super-soldier virus to terrorists.

Mark Ruffalo says the Hulk has ‘found his family’ Tom Hiddleston hopes for Loki’s redemptionToy solicitations have a track record of spilling movie secrets and Lego have certainly been repeat offenders. This time, though, they at least tried to protect us from the spoiler. According to Brick Fanatic, one tie-in Iron Man 3 Lego kit will come with: Tony Stark, Iron Man mk42, Pepper Potts, Mandarin and a pale green bad guy we were not allowed to know the name of. Sounds like he looked like Radioactive Man. No, not from The Simpsons. It was rumoured before that Xueqi Wang would play Radioactive Man’s alias Chen Lu in the film but he was later announced as playing Dr. Wu. So either Wu is an alias, somebody else is playing Lu in the film or Lego will be selling us a different pale green naughty – which may or may not be in the actual movie. I’m going for option two.
